Guide Review - Bioelements: Sleepwear for Eyes
Bioelements: Sleepwear for Eyes is part of Bioelements Sleepwear line of night time products made to reduce the signs of aging. The line includes a moisturizer for oily to combo skin, a moisturizer for dry to normal skin, and this product, a night time eye cream.
Bioelements claims that Sleepwear for Eyes will decreases wrinkle length and depth (crows feet), reduce fine lines and strengthen and firm the skin around your eyes while you sleep.
The eye cream comes in a small glass tub with a spatula for sanitary application. The cream itself is white in color and is very thick in consistency. The scent is very mild, and dissolves very quickly.
When applying Bioelements: Sleepwear for Eyes, it feels as though your skin instantly drinks it in. It absorbs extremely fast, and you're left with skin that feels very hydrated and pampered. Although the product description might lead you to believe your crows feet will be gone the next morning, we all know that isn't true. But that doesn't mean there aren't visible results.
I absolutely notice that my eyes look more rested and plumped each morning after use. But when reading reviews from people who use this on a regular basis, the consensus was almost always positive. Many reviewers gave this product the most stars available and claimed it worked amazing wonders on their fine lines and even crows feet in some instances.
I looked long and hard to find negative reviews and only came up with a single review that claimed the product didn't work as claimed. This single review was in the mix of almost all top star reviews.
$50 may seem like a lot to spend on an eye cream, but with the thick consistency, you can be sure that this product will last a long time, as a little goes a long way and you only use it in the evenings.
